Men who are overweight have a higher chance of surviving a car crash if they’re wearing a safety belt, a University of Michigan study found out.

The U-M Transportation Research Institute study found men who were overweight had a 22 percent lower chance of being killed in a fatal crash than men who are underweight. But the opposite was true if overweight weren’t buckled in.  According to the study, men with a body mass index between 35 and 50 were 10 percent more likely to be killed in an auto accident.

Overall, drivers who don’t wear safety belts are 2.1 times more likely to die in a fatal crash than those who are belted.

The researchers suggested design of airbags, knee restraints and seats might need to be redesigned to protect people who have extreme BMIs.
